We hiked up hill for 45 minutes
in wetsuits and bouyancy aids to the base of a
massive waterfall, where we were given a safety
briefing before starting our descent down the
canyon. There were whoops of joy, screams of
terror and a few tears along the way, but after
numerous slides, lowers, leaps and prayers we all
made it, safe and excited, back to the bottom.
The next day was one of rest and an opportunity
to explore the town of Pokhara, albeit for a short
time, before we hit the road again and headed for
the Kali Gandaki, one of the holiest rivers in the
country. The water was colder and more powerful
and the rapids were definitely bigger and harder
than the Seti. The crux of the trip were the two
rapids, Big Brother and Little Brother. Both had
the group out on the side inspecting and
deciding whether to paddle, raft or walk around,
which took some time!
